Checklist I Use to Spot a Counterfeit
Price Too Good to Be True – If the discount is >30% off retail, treat it as a red flag.
Seller Reputation – look alike bags for verified sales history, return policies, fake bag and detailed product descriptions.
Material Feel – Authentic bags use heavyweight, water‑resistant nylon or full‑grain leather; fakes often feel cheap, thin, or plasticky.
Stitching & Edge Finishing – Genuine Balenciaga stitching is even, tight, and never frayed; counterfeit stitching may be uneven or have loose threads.
Hardware Quality – Real bags have solid, gold‑tone hardware with a weight you can feel; fakes often use hollow, lightweight metal.
Logo Placement & Font – The “B” logo is precisely centered, with a specific font weight and spacing. Any misalignment is suspect.
Serial Numbers & Authenticity Tags – Authentic pieces come with a leather tag inside, a serial number, and a QR code that can be verified on Balenciaga’s site.

- Side‑by‑Side: Authentic vs. Fake Balenciaga Bum Bag
Aspect Authentic Balenciaga Common Counterfeit
Material 100% nylon (water‑resistant) or full‑grain leather; heavy feel Thin polyester, low‑grade faux leather; floppy
Hardware Solid gold‑tone metal, weight >10 g, engraved “BALENCIAGA” Hollow metal, lightweight, often unengraved or poorly engraved
Logo Precisely centered, perfect spacing, no smudging; font size 13 mm Off‑center, slightly distorted, uneven edges
Stitching Double‑stitched, uniform 2 mm spacing, no loose ends Single‑stitched, irregular spacing, visible thread ends
Inside Tag Black leather tag with stamped serial number, “BALENCIAGA” embossing, QR code Printed paper tag, missing QR code, misspelled words
Zipper Pull Branded “B” pull with smooth glide, metal teeth Plain plastic pull, rough or squeaky glide
Packaging Official Balenciaga dust bag, authenticity card, polished box Generic dust bag, no authenticity card, cheap cardboard box

- How to Safely Purchase an Authentic Balenciaga Bum Bag
Below is my step‑by‑step guide that helped me finally secure an authentic bag without breaking the bank.
Step Action Why It Helps
1 Set a realistic budget – $900‑$1,300 for a new piece, $400‑$800 for a pre‑owned one. Avoids impulse buys and unrealistic expectations.
2 Shop reputable sources – Official Balenciaga boutiques, authorized luxury department stores (e.g., Nordstrom, Selfridges), replica designer bags usa or kelly replica bag trusted resale platforms (TheRealReal, Vestiaire Collective). Guarantees authentication and return policies.
3 Ask for detailed photos – Inside tag, serial number, hardware close‑ups. Allows you to verify authenticity before purchase.
4 Verify serial numbers – Use Balenciaga’s QR code check or contact customer service with the number. Confirms the bag’s production batch and legitimacy.
5 Inspect the bag in person (if possible) – Feel the weight, examine stitching, test the zipper. Hands‑on evaluation catches subtle fakes that photos hide.
6 Check the return policy – At least 30‑day returns for peace of mind. Protects you if you later discover a discrepancy.
7 Consider a professional authentication service – Services like Authenticate First or Entrupy (for online sales). Independent verification adds an extra layer of security.
